Hyperion delivers Hydro-cracking Model and Reforming Model for O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” Refinery in Yaroslavl, Russia
Nicosia, Cyprus (PRWEB UK) 29 August 2013 -- Hyperion Systems Engineering (Hyperion), the leading independent solutions provider to the global process industries, announces the successful delivery of two Reactor Model systems for the Reforming and Hydro-cracking Units at O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” Refinery in Yaroslavl, Russia. The Reactor Models were delivered in partnership with KBC Technologies.
Hyperion’s turnkey responsibilities on the Reactor Models project included the following activities for each unit:
• Software installation and commissioning at site
• Data collection and validation
• Model building: calibration of the models based on the real data from the actual refinery units
• Periodical model recalibrations
• Model and software maintenance
• Provision of series of trainings on Petro-SIM, AMSIM, DISTOP, and Reactor Models (REF-SIM, HCR-SIM)
• Provision of tutorials, manuals and other appropriate documentation
Hyperion and O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” have also developed an action plan that includes building a rigorous model of FCC-SIM unit, creating integration between the refinery’s planning system (PIMS) and the models, as well as other projects that will result in having an integrated refinery-wide model.
Mr. Rumyantsev, the Head of Technical Department at OAO “Slavneft-YANOS,” stated, “We have been actively using the KBC reforming and hydro-cracking reactor models on the Petro-SIM Express platform for some years now, and we have been repeatedly convinced of their high quality and efficiency. With their use we were able to create accurate kinetic models of our plant units, predict their working parameters, as well as improve our production planning operations. The most significant effect results from integration with PIMS, with the generation of vectors for linear programming. We look forward to continuing the cooperation with Hyperion towards the creation of a complete integrated model for the whole Refinery.”

About Slavneft-Yanos Refinery
O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” is Slavneft’s largest oil refinery with a rated annual capacity of 15.0 mln tons.
O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” outputs over 100 types of products, including high-quality motor gasoline, eco-friendly diesel fuel, jet fuel, base oils, bitumen, paraffins and waxes, aromatic hydrocarbons and furnace fuel. Many of these products are winners at local, regional, and Russian-wide competitions. In 2009, O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” was awarded the Prize of the Russian Federation Government for great achievements in the field of products quality enhancement and introduction of the effective management methods.
From the end of the 1990s, O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” has been implementing a large-scale upgrade program. During this period, 19 major processing units were reconstructed and built, including construction of a high-end deep oil processing plant, consisting of hydro-cracking, visbreaking and catalytic reforming units.
In 2011, O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” launched С5-С6 fractions of isomerization unit, and cat-cracked gasoline hydrotreatment unit. Commissioning of these industrial facilities enabled OAO “Slavneft-YANOS” to fully convert to production of motor gasolines and commercial diesel fuel under the environmental standard Euro-5 from July 2012.

About KBC Technologies
A leading independent consultancy and software company dedicated to the design, operation and management of hydrocarbon processing facilities worldwide, generates value and reduces risk by empowering our clients with advice and technology to deliver enduring excellence in safety, profitability and environmental performance.
For more than 33 years, KBC has provided best-practice solutions and software to the refining industry. Most of the major international, national and independent oil and energy companies have engaged KBC to help them formulate and execute corporate strategy, develop superior return-on-capital investments, improve the effectiveness and profitability of existing assets, and sustainably develop their workforce.

About Hyperion
Hyperion Systems Engineering is a globally operating, independent provider of consulting & advisory services, systems engineering solutions and professional implementation services and support to process manufacturers. With 20 years of experience in the Upstream Oil & Gas, Petroleum Refining & Petrochemicals, Chemical, Power, Water and Metals industries, Hyperion helps its customers reduce operating and supply chain costs, improve safety and increase their overall profitability, always cognisant of environmental impact.
Employing a workforce of top engineers, consultants and project managers distributed across several locations, Hyperion operates world-wide delivering systems engineering solutions in areas such as Process Modeling and Optimisation, Operator Training Simulators, Basic and Advanced Process Control, Manufacturing Execution Systems, Data Validation and Reconciliation, Laboratory Information Systems, Plant Performance Management and Advanced Supply Chain Planning and Scheduling.
Hyperion’s professional advisory and consulting services range from Strategic Opportunity Assessment, Technology Readiness and Front End Engineering Design studies, Project Management Consulting and Program Management, to knowledge transfer assurance, technology review, training and education.
Hyperion Systems Engineering Ltd. is a company incorporated under the laws of the Republic of Cyprus and is the holding company of the Hyperion Systems Engineering group with registered subsidiaries in Greece, China, Russian Federation, Singapore,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, Kingdom of Bahrain, India, United Kingdom and the United States.
